  • Patent number: 11693945
    Abstract: A security configuration file is received from a first application, the security configuration file including information of an authority. The first application assigns the authority to a second application to enable the second application to trigger jobs at the first application, and the second application provides shared services to a plurality of applications including the first application. A query is received from the second application and in response the authority is sent to the second application. A request for a token is received from the second application, the request including the authority. A token including the authority is sent to the second application. The second application sends the token to the first application when the second application triggers jobs at the first application.

  • Patent number: 9111086
    Abstract: In an external system, a request handler may receive, at the external system, a logon ticket from a proprietary software system, the logon ticket associated with a request from a user of the proprietary system for access to the external system. A ticket handler may provide the logon ticket to an authentication service which is configured to perform a validation of the logon ticket at the proprietary system. A session manager may receive, from the authentication service and based on the validation, a user session and access rights related to the requested access. An access control manager may provide the requested access to the user via the proprietary system, according to the access rights and within the user session.

  • Patent number: 4953691
    Abstract: A roller chain conveyor including detachable, snap-on, top-plate assemblies having spaced apart, guide plate members adaptable to overlap the outer ends of connecting pins, so as to avoid contact thereof with laterally disposed guide tracks, especially during operation of the conveyor along curvilinear paths of travel in which transverse forces act on the roller chain. The absorption of the transverse forces occurs over guide plates that overlap the roller chain conveyor. The assemblies include a plurality of resilient, spring-like tongue members disposed about each guide plate member, the tongue members having recesses formed therein to receive in holding engagement a portion of the circumferential surface of each of the connecting pins. This arrangement, whereby there is provided a distinct, rigid, separate guide plate member and a resiient spring-like tongue member, provides a simple device for attachment and removal of the snap-on top plate assemblies to and from the roller chain.

  • Patent number: 3940122
    Abstract: In a quick acting clamping device a pair of pressure levers are mounted in a cylindrical housing for displacement between an unclamped position and a clamped position. In the unclamped position the pressure levers extend obliquely to the cylindrical axis of the housing and in the clamped position they extend parallel to the cylindrical axis. Movement of the pressure levers between the clamped and unclamped positions is provided by mounting one end of each of the levers in a pressure piece. The pressure piece is located in a bore in a piston mounted in another bore within the cylindrical housing. The bore in which the piston is mounted extends transversely of the housing, while the bore in the piston extends in the direction of the cylindrical axis of the housing. The housing includes passageways for introducing pressurized hydraulic fluid into the opposite ends of the bore containing the piston.
